你查询的IP:[203.212.234.123]  地理位置:印度Hathway网络用户

最新查询202.95.34.73 119.179.194.230 121.255.70.91 118.228.126.38 124.242.53.127 122.96.197.254 202.130.3.205 121.224.136.55 59.172.227.53 203.212.234.123 218.56.139.11 202.8.128.56 117.60.112.27 117.122.128.153 59.191.240.185 117.103.16.18 202.38.149.77 118.67.112.65 58.68.128.245 202.96.59.69 120.92.176.85 122.48.120.206 118.132.229.124 221.192.14.226 119.58.92.90 59.107.37.124 202.90.224.80 117.44.29.211 119.176.114.206 203.191.64.15 120.24.189.149